Output 2e64b6b2c23f37c0aaa8f34b34c83a9b24a309aaf68cdbff274f4246e9f228f2:2

value
13880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9325ab9e333ce03cf53b4b4636285ae73ce7b5 OP_EQUAL
address
3EbbUZ9UDDF5SRDLjyGr9Pq9Yb3Rdny3CB
transaction
2e64b6b2c23f37c0aaa8f34b34c83a9b24a309aaf68cdbff274f4246e9f228f2
confirmations
414692
spent
true